I had a friend of mine at work that also has the x that had terrible battery drain after the update, like a full discharge in a few hours with no use. Took it back to verizon and they told him it was lookout mobile security causing it. He uninstalled it and is now getting like 1-1.5 days of use out of it with moderate use.
